The launch of Bitcoin ETFs, the first of their kind, was considered a game-changer and a significant milestone in the crypto industry. This is because it offered investors an accessible and regulated approach to investing in Bitcoin, which, in turn, could lead to the mass adoption of Bitcoin as an investment asset. Exchange-traded funds (ETFs) have been around for decades in the traditional financial markets.

By definition, Ethereum is a blockchain-based software platform that serves multiple functions. It uses its own cryptocurrency (Ether) that can be used as a store of value or traded on the Ethereum network. The main benefit of using Ethereum, and similar to other cryptocurrencies, is that it operates as a decentralised platform.
